On cask at Indie Scotland. Appearance - clear copper. Proportionate off white head. Nose - caramel and honeycomb. Taste - honeycomb again, malt loaf, ginger biscuit. Palate - medium bodied, sweet and creamy. Overall - doesn't taste like a lager, bit not unpleasant.

Keg at the Clachaig Inn. The taste is clear yellow with a decent white head. The aroma is fresh, floral, straw, grass and some white bread. The taste is crisp, dry, clean, straw, white bread, cracker, floral and lemongrass with a dry finish. Medium body and moderate carbonation. Perhaps not a huge amount going on, but it is clean, dry and very drinkable. Decent for the style.
